http://www4.ohsonline.com/Articles/2024/06/01/HiVis-101-Everything-You-Need-to-Know.aspx WebDec 15, 2024 · The standard for high-visibility safety apparel is ANSI/ISEA 107. It specifies high-visibility garments' design and performance requirements to increase the wearer's visibility in low light and other potentially hazardous situations. WebHigh-Visibility Safety Apparel (HVSA): Personal protective safety clothing intended to provide conspicuity during both daytime and nighttime, and other low-light conditions. Photometric Performance: The effectiveness of retroreflective material in returning light to its source and measured in terms of coefficient of retroreflection (RA).
